Toyota Yaris: Rear window defogger - Lights, Wipers and Defogger - Toyota Yaris XP90 2005–2010 Owner's ManualToyota Yaris: Rear window defogger

To defog or defrost the rear window, push the switch.

The key must be in the “ON” position.

The thin heater wires on the inside of the rear window will quickly clear the surface.

An indicator light will illuminate to indicate the defogger is operating.

Push the switch once again to turn the defogger off.

Make sure you turn the defogger off when the window is clear. Leaving the defogger on for a long time could cause the battery to discharge, especially during stop-and- go driving. The defogger is not designed for drying rain water or for melting snow.

NOTICE.

To prevent the battery from being discharged, turn the switch off when the engine is not running.

When cleaning the inside of the rear window, be careful not to scratch or damage the heater wires or connectors.
